Tom Smythe — Electronics Technician & AV/Security Systems Installer
From 2017 to 2023, Tom co-owned and operated Av Architects Ltd, designing, selling, hiring and installing audio-visual, security and IT equipment for commercial, residential and industrial clients.
Earlier in his career, Tom worked as an AV technician for Ministry of Sound Ltd in London, installing, commissioning and maintaining nightclub and conferencing systems — including Crestron and BSS DSP control — as part of a kinetic light rig install team.
Tom brings more than 20 years' experience in live sound, events, audio production and engineering, including stage management for Bay Dreams Nelson and site management and H&S coordination for Coca-Cola Christmas in the Park, and has worked as a tutor at SIT.
Alongside his AV and security work, Tom runs an ongoing self-employed cellphone and computer parts repair and fault-finding business, started in 2015, and designs and installs networking and wireless infrastructure.
He handles his own health & safety documentation — job hazard analysis, site inductions and subcontractor safety paperwork — and owns his own test equipment, tools and access gear, so he arrives ready to work on any site.
